Sarah's tour bus then took us to a place called Deadwood, which is essentally a casino town in the middle of the state. All the buildings were straight out of the 1800's and housed many types of casinos. In one of them was where the origin of the "Dead Man's Hand" began. It was the place Wild Bill was shot and they have the chair he was sitting in up on the wall, complete with bullethole in the back. Pretty crazy.
